Abstract

The introduction of robotic technology in the context of elderly care poses new privacy challenges. We conducted a systematic literature review of publications from 2010 to mid-2023, focusing on privacy-related concerns and efforts to resolve privacy conflicts associated with the use of robotic technologies in elderly care. The review is organized into three key discussion points: (a) conceptions of privacy, where we explore the multifaceted and multidimensional nature of privacy, building on Burgoon’s work; (b) privacy concerns, which we categorize using Rueben’s taxonomy of privacy constructs; and (c) mitigation strategies for addressing these concerns. Our analysis reveals that current design practices for robotic technologies in elderly care predominantly emphasize informational aspects of privacy. However, adopting a holistic approach to privacy is more advantageous. To extend privacy protection beyond mere data protection, we develop a framework that matches different mitigation strategies with privacy concerns across the identified dimensions of privacy, recognizing that no single approach is universally applicable across all aspects of privacy. We accomplish this by proposing an integration with existing privacy impact assessments and apply our findings to the design of robotic technology for elderly care.
